Analysis
The most recent figure for mean income or consumption per day: 2017 vs. 2021 international-$ in Madagascar is 2.91 international-$ in 2021 prices, measured in 2021.
The figure is down 12.7% over ten years.
Over the whole period, mean income or consumption per day: 2017 vs. 2021 international-$ in Madagascar peaked at 4.11 international-$ in 2021 prices in 2001 and was at its lowest, 2.17 international-$ in 2021 prices, in 1997.
Madagascar ranks 116th of 120 countries on this measure, in the bottom quarter.
Mean income or consumption per day: 2017 vs. 2021 international-$ in Madagascar, year by year
| Year | international-$ in 2021 prices | Change |
|---|---|---|
| 1980 | 3.58 international-$ in 2021 prices | — |
| 1993 | 2.26 international-$ in 2021 prices | -36.7% |
| 1997 | 2.17 international-$ in 2021 prices | -4.3% |
| 1999 | 2.21 international-$ in 2021 prices | +2.0% |
| 2001 | 4.11 international-$ in 2021 prices | +86.0% |
| 2005 | 3.84 international-$ in 2021 prices | -6.7% |
| 2010 | 3.34 international-$ in 2021 prices | -13.0% |
| 2012 | 3.13 international-$ in 2021 prices | -6.1% |
| 2021 | 2.91 international-$ in 2021 prices | -7.1% |
